Insolvency Practitioners have two major functions serving as consultants and in the monitoring of insolvent estates


As supervisors of bankrupt estates, the Insolvency Practitioner has 2 main purposes. The initial is to determine all possessions held by the bankrupt entity both real, contingent, well-known and unidentified, for returning these funds to financial institutions in order of concern. The second, is to identify transgression by the financially troubled company/ individual and record this misconducting to the Insolvency Solution or any kind of other appropriate regulatory authorities to consider if it is in the general public rate of interest to take activity versus the directors of the financially troubled business, or the people, due to their conduct.

A Bankruptcy Professional can be compensated in a number of means, the most usual being fixed fee or a time expense basis. Advisory work will normally have a defined extent and concurred charge, with further charges being incurred where work is asked for beyond the extent of the interaction. Costs for insolvent estate are most frequently requested on a time expense basis, with a quote given by the Bankruptcy Professional for approval by the ideal body of creditors.




As an example, a liquidation of an owner managed firm with one staff member without assets would certainly be a cheaper exercise than the administration of a company trading 50 stores with 200 personnel, as more general job is needed. An Insolvency Professional will normally look for to understand the facts and the extent of the interaction, at which stage they will certainly have the ability to provide a sign as to fees they would anticipate


Just a Bankruptcy expert (or an click site Authorities Receiver licenced by the Insolvency Service) can act as a liquidator in the UK. A liquidator is the name utilized to refer to a Bankruptcy Practitioner who has been selected over a firm in liquidation (insolvency practitioner). On consenting to act and obtaining the appointment as liquidator the Bankruptcy Practitioner has the power to take care of the business and events of the company

Bankruptcy specialists have a variety of powers that rely on the nature of the interaction they are taking care of. Typically bankruptcy experts will certainly have the complying with powers: The ability to put on Court for directions regarding what to do in an offered situation The ability to put on Court to oblige 3rd events to give information concerning the bankrupt's events and transactions The capacity to offer/ desert or otherwise handle the insolvent's possessions The ability to examine the events of the bankrupt The capacity to commence procedures either in their own or the financially troubled's name to look for a recuperation for lenders The capacity to concur the cases of financial institutions and ultimately make dividend repayments The capacity to do all such things as they might fairly need to do in order to handle the affairs of insolvent The ability to become part of compromise agreements on the financially troubled's behalf for the benefit of financial institutions and The ability to instruct solicitors, representatives and various other third celebrations to act upon part of the insolvent.
